How much do director of learning and development j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average yearly pay for director of learning and development in Arizona is $105,883.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$84,300.00 and $123,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a director of learning and development do?

A Director of Learning and Development is responsible for overseeing an organization's training and professional development programs. They assess the company's needs, design effective learning strategies, and ensure employees have access to resources that enhance their skills and performance. This role involves collaborating with leadership to align training initiatives with business goals, managing training budgets, and evaluating the effectiveness of educational programs. The Director also stays updated on trends in learning technologies and adult education to continuously improve organizational grow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a director of learning and development?

To thrive as a Director of Learning and Development, you need expertise in instructional design, adult learning theories, organizational development, and typically a degree in HR, education, or a related field.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), e-learning platforms, and certifications like CPLP or SHRM are often required. Outstanding leadership, strategic thinking, and strong communication skills help you inspire teams and align training initiatives with business goals. These competencies ensure that learning programs drive employee growth and organizational success in a competitive environment.

What are some common challenges faced by a director of learning and development, and how can they be addressed?

A Director of Learning and Development often faces challenges such as aligning training initiatives with evolving business objectives, demonstrating the ROI of learning programs, and ensuring employee engagement across diverse teams. To address these, it's crucial to maintain close collaboration with key stakeholders, utilize data-driven approaches to measure program effectiveness, and foster a culture of continuous learning. Regular feedback loops and staying updated with industry trends also help adapt strategies to meet organizational needs.

What You'll be Doing 
Do you have a passion to train, enable, and elevate performance at scale? Ready to help people reach for amazing while driving measurable business results? As a Sales Enablement Manager, you'll lead, coach, and support a high-performing team of Sales Trainers and Quality Analysts (QAs), ensuring excellence across learning delivery, quality execution, and sales performance outcomes. 

You'll evaluate learning outcomes, quality results, curricula, and processes, while continuously evolving enablement strategies to support revenue growth, productivity, and client satisfaction. You'll lead your team to attain sales, productivity, and quality goals, aligning enablement initiatives directly to business priorities.

You'll report to the Director - Learning & Development and play a critical role in driving the success of the business, sales professionals, and client partnerships through impactful sales enablement programs.

During a Typical Day, You'll

  • Develop and Implement Sales Training Programs: Design, create, and deliver comprehensive training programs for existing sales team members, focusing on product knowledge, sales strategies, sales tools, and soft skills.

  • Lead and Develop Trainers and QAs: Directly manage, coach, and develop a team of Sales Trainers and Quality Analysts, ensuring strong calibration between training, quality, and performance outcomes while building internal capability and career growth.

  • Content Creation and Management: Produce and manage sales enablement content, including playbooks, training materials, and sales and quality guidelines, ensuring that all content is up-to-date and easily accessible.

  • Quality Strategy and Governance: Oversee quality frameworks for sales programs, ensuring consistent evaluation standards, actionable feedback loops, and strong alignment between quality insights, coaching plans, and enablement interventions.

  • Performance Analysis and Business Impact: Analyze sales, quality, and productivity metrics to identify performance gaps, trends, and opportunities. Translate insights into targeted enablement plans that drive revenue growth, conversion improvement, and sustained performance gains.

  • Collaboration with Sales Operations and Client Stakeholders: Partner closely with Ops leadership teams and client stakeholders to align enablement priorities with business goals, client expectations, and go-to-market strategies

  • Sales Support: Provide support to sales team members, helping them develop their skills and achieve their individual and team targets, inclusive of supporting new logo deals and embedded base client's growth.

  • Client Engagement and Innovation: Collaborate with client stakeholders to understand business objectives and co-create innovative enablement solutions that enhance sales effectiveness, client satisfaction, and long-term partnership value.

  • Sales Onboarding Excellence: Oversee the onboarding process for new sales hires, ensuring they are fully equipped and prepared to start selling effectively from day one.

What You Bring to the Role

  • Bachelor's degree in business, marketing, education, or a related field.

  • Proven experience in sales enablement, sales training, or a similar role.

  • Strong understanding of sales processes, methodologies and performance drivers 

  • Excellent communication, presentation, organizational and stakeholder management skills.

  • Strong collaboration skills with cross-functional and client-facing teams.

  • Proficiency in sales tools and Microsoft and Google technologies (e.g., CRM, sales analytics software).
